Twitter to launch cryptocurrency trading feature

Twitter (the social network is blocked in Russia) will provide users with the opportunity to trade cryptocurrencies, stocks and other financial assets, informs CNBC. To do this, Elon Musk’s social network has entered into a partnership with the eToro trading platform. RBC Crypto.

Established in Israel in 2007, eToro is an online brokerage platform that supports the trading of cryptocurrencies, stocks and index funds.

Starting April 13, the Twitter app will launch a new feature. It will allow users to view price charts, buy and sell assets from eToro, according to the publication. There will be a button that says “look at eToro”, which leads to the website of the brokerage platform, where you can buy and sell assets.

The ability to track prices for cryptocurrencies and stocks, according to the TradingView platform, appeared on Twitter at the end of 2022. This can be done using the “cashtags” function – an asset ticker with a $ sign in front of it is entered into the search box, after which the application displays the current value of the asset in US dollars and a price movement chart.

Since the beginning of 2023, there have been more than 420 million cache searches on the app, with an average of about 4.7 million searches per day.

At the end of January, journalists reported that Musk’s social network was developing a built-in payment system and had already begun to apply for the necessary licenses in the United States. At first, the Twitter payment system will be fiat, but built in such a way as to add cryptocurrencies later.
